Isis Snake Divination
Spring is the time of nature, revelation, and discovery. Just as plants peek out of the ground, so do snakes and other creatures that have rested over the winter. March is the time of Isis, moon mother, and mother of the sea. Snakes are one of her symbols. This ritual respectfully conjures her symbolic reptile, paying tribute to her while invoking her spirit.
- Draw a bath.
- Into the bath, pour 1/4 cup Epsom salt, 1/4 cup coarse and 1/4 cup fine Dead Sea salt.
- Put on a piece of moonstone (ring, necklace, bracelet, or anklet).
- Light a blue candle and place on a fireproof container near the bathtub.
- Bring a crystal ball (or clear quartz crystal) with you into the bath.
Gaze at the candle as you breathe deeply and very slowly until you are very relaxed. Realize that you are breathing in the smoke of Isis.
Call her name quietly but deliberately, drawing it out slowly like a snake’s hiss. “I-sis, I-sis, I-sis.” Breathe in and with the exhale whisper, “I-sis.” Do this for about five minutes.
Lift the crystal ball into the air once you feel the spirit of Isis within the room. Hold the ball in front of the candle flame. See what is in store as you divine by scrying both fire and crystal.
